What are factors affecting birth rate?

- Access to birth control

- Sex Education

- State of personal economy

- Rural vs Urban lifestyle (higher in rural economies, lower in urban)

- race/culture/nationality

- Access to medical care

How do birth rate and death rate affect a country's population?

If the birth rate is higher than the death rate, the population increases. If the death rate is higher than the birth rate, the population decreases.

What happens to population growth if the death rate is higher than the birth rate?

The population growth will decline since more people are dying then being born subject to condition that migration factor remains constant

What are the birth rate and death rate of China?

National birth rates are expressed as number of live births per year per 1,000 of the population, with population taken at the (estimated) mid-year figure.

The estimated birth rate for China in 2009 was 14 births for every 1,000 people. (14/1,000)

The death rate is expressed in a similar way.

The estimated death rate for China in 2009 was 7.06 deaths per 1,000 people. (7.06/1,000)

The CIA World Factbook gives the following estimates for China for 2010:

Birth rate: 12.17/1,000

Death rate: 6.89/1,000

(sourced June 8, 2010)

What are the causes of high birth rate in India 9-10points?

  • Early Marriage System : Early marriages are commonly seen in our country. It is generally in the case of women. Maximum number of girls are married between 16 to 18 years. Early marriageprolongs the childbearing period and this leads to a high rate of growth of population.
  • Universal Marriage : Marriage is universal practice and regarded as a sacred obligation in India. Presently in India about 76 per cent of the women are married at their reproductive age. By attaining the age of 50 only 5 out of 100 Indian women remain unmarried. As marriage is universal in our country, the birth rate becomes higher which raise the growth rate pf population.
  • Joint Family System : Thought the importance of jointly family system has considerably declined in our country the system has no disappeared till now. In a joint family system the children are looked after by all the earning members of the family. The system acts a protection against economic hardship. A member may not be in a position to earn something but when he gets married he gets more children. The birth rate as a result of which population increases.
  • Poverty : Poverty is another factor which is mostly responsible for the rapid growth of population. India houses are the museum of poverty. According to 2001 census, nearly 37 per cent of people live below the poverty line. Small children in poor families are put to work and this helps to increase the family income. Children in poor families are considered as assets.
  • Illiteracy, ignorance and superstitions : A majority of population in our country are illiterates. When illiteracy is combined with poverty it leads to firm belief a superstition. Children are considered as the gifts of God. They know nothing about the birth control measures. All those account of a higher birth rate in India's population.
  • Attitude towards male child : Every Indians wants to have a male child. A male child is considered as an asset for the poor, a dowry earner for the greedy, and liberator for the God fearing, a life insurance for the middle man and a matter of pride for the mother.
